We didn't have any toll roads till a couple of years ago. A private company made one, called Highway 6, and it's spread across the country, I gotta say it's wonderful! I can pay everything for that... No police at every corner so you can speed up a bit, no traffic jams and no stopping to pay the toll prices either. There's a special systme that photographs your license plate and the payment gets sent to you. If you don't pay, next time your car is spotted on the highway you'll catch the highway police behind you. Wonderful system, they should make more roads like that. Plus it's really pretty!
